How much does it cost to rent a home in Andover?
| Bedroom | Average Price | Cheapest Price | Highest Price |
|---|---|---|---|
| Andover 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,611 | $2,100 | $3,500 |
| Andover 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$3,591 | $2,300 | $7,000 |
| Andover 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$6,421 | $3,500 | $10,000+ |
| Andover 5 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$10,450 | $10,000 | $10,000+ |

Frequently Asked Questions about Andover
What type of rentals are currently available in Andover?
There are currently 476 Apartments for Rent in Andover, MA with pricing that ranges from $1,395 to $26,020. There are also 67 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Andover ranging from $800 to $10,900.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Andover?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Andover ranges from $800 to $10,900 with an average monthly rent of $3,381.
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Andover?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Andover range from $2,150 to $4,550,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$2,300 to $7,000.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$3,500 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$2,350.
